Credit score

Hi, I need some advice about my credit score. A few years ago my husband lost his job, this put us in debt & we ended up in an IVA. We are now a few months awAy from the final payment, during the IVA I have never defaulted on my mortgage payments, we have lived in the same house for 20 years I have had the same job for 20 years my husband now has a stable job & has for the past 2 years. I know the iva will affect my credit score but wondering if the fact I'm a home owner would help the score? I tried using clear score but it said it could provide a report.

    Don't worry about the score, well you can if you like but lenders don't see it. The score/rating can be a reflection of your history (the score can be deceptive as you can have defaults and have a high score) but not all 3 reference agencies use the same score. Your credit history is what's important.

    Ignore the score.

    The IVA will damage you in the eyes of lenders so you need to make sure that everything else is ok - be on the electoral roll, manage other credit correctly, carry as little revolving debt as possible.
